What does this tool do?
Aptabase is an open-source, privacy-focused analytics platform designed specifically for mobile, desktop, and web applications. It provides developers with a lightweight, anonymous tracking solution that eliminates the complex privacy concerns associated with traditional analytics tools. Unlike Google Firebase Analytics, Aptabase focuses on collecting completely anonymized data without using device identifiers, cookies, or long-term user tracking, making it particularly attractive for privacy-conscious developers and applications.

Key Features
- Real-time event tracking across multiple platforms
- Automatic debug/release mode detection
- Built-in mobile and web dashboards
- EU and US data residency options
- CSV data export capability
- Lightweight SDKs for multiple development frameworks

Pros & Cons
Advantages
- 100% open-source with full code transparency
- Truly anonymous data collection without personal identifiers
- Supports over 10 different development platforms and frameworks
- Real-time data updates and mobile-friendly dashboard
Limitations
- Limited to 20,000 events per month on free tier
- Relatively new tool with potentially smaller community compared to established analytics platforms
- May require additional configuration for complex tracking scenarios
Pricing Details
Free tier with 20,000 monthly events, unlimited apps, EU/US data residency, and full feature set. No explicit pricing for paid tiers mentioned.
